Output 2707268314effeb05b05d1c4188d29ed3a0be177c7201ada66933c4be9a7d047:0

value
865059
script pubkey
OP_0 OP_PUSHBYTES_20 ad74db33d4babdfd62104ac046f8f6d50051a7c4
address
bc1q446dkv75h27l6cssftqyd78k65q9rf7yglalws
transaction
2707268314effeb05b05d1c4188d29ed3a0be177c7201ada66933c4be9a7d047
spent
true